Jennifer Lawrence has playfully suggested her potential return as Katniss Everdreen in the upcoming "Hunger Games" prequel, "Sunrise on the Reaping." The actress hinted at her involvement during a recent podcast appearance, sparking excitement among fans.
The film is set to explore the tumultuous past of Haymitch Abernathy, detailing his harrowing experience surviving the 50th Hunger Games. This prequel story is an adaptation of Suzanne Collins' newly released novel and takes place 24 years prior to the events familiar to audiences from the original book trilogy.
Directed by Francis Lawrence, who helmed the first four "Hunger Games" films, the project continues Lionsgate's highly successful franchise. The previous films, including the 2024 prequel "The Ballad of Songbirds and Snakes," have collectively grossed $3.3 billion worldwide.
